We start with a couple of house-keeping patches that were
originally presented for 'net', then we add support for on-chip
descriptor rings and Rx buffer page cacheing.

Neel Patel (1):
  ionic: page cache for rx buffers

Shannon Nelson (3):
  ionic: remove unnecessary indirection
  ionic: remove unnecessary void casts
  ionic: add support for device Component Memory Buffers

The ionic device has on-board memory (CMB) that can be used
for descriptors as a way to speed descriptor access for faster
traffic processing.  It imposes a couple of restrictions so
is not on by default, but can be enabled through the ethtool
priv-flags.

+static int ionic_cmb_reconfig(struct ionic_lif *lif,
+			      struct ionic_queue_params *qparam)
+{
+	struct ionic_queue_params start_qparams;
+	int err = 0;
+
+	/* When changing CMB queue parameters, we're using limited
+	 * on-device memory and don't have extra memory to use for
+	 * duplicate allocations, so we free it all first then
+	 * re-allocate with the new parameters.
+	 */
+
+	/* Checkpoint for possible unwind */
+	ionic_init_queue_params(lif, &start_qparams);
+
+	/* Stop and free the queues */
+	ionic_stop_queues_reconfig(lif);
+	ionic_txrx_free(lif);
+
+	/* Set up new qparams */
+	ionic_set_queue_params(lif, qparam);
+
+	if (netif_running(lif->netdev)) {
+		/* Alloc and start the new configuration */
+		err = ionic_txrx_alloc(lif);
+		if (err) {
+			dev_warn(lif->ionic->dev,
+				 "CMB reconfig failed, restoring values: %d\n", err);
+
+			/* Back out the changes */
+			ionic_set_queue_params(lif, &start_qparams);
+			err = ionic_txrx_alloc(lif);
+			if (err) {
+				dev_err(lif->ionic->dev,
+					"CMB restore failed: %d\n", err);
+				goto errout;
+			}
+		}
+
+		ionic_start_queues_reconfig(lif);
+	} else {
+		/* This was detached in ionic_stop_queues_reconfig() */
+		netif_device_attach(lif->netdev);
+	}
+
+errout:
+	return err;
+}

+static bool ionic_rx_cache_put(struct ionic_queue *q,
+			       struct ionic_buf_info *buf_info)
+{
+	struct ionic_page_cache *cache = &q->page_cache;
+	struct ionic_rx_stats *stats = q_to_rx_stats(q);
+	u32 tail_next;
+
+	tail_next = (cache->tail + 1) & (IONIC_PAGE_CACHE_SIZE - 1);
+	if (tail_next == cache->head) {
+		stats->cache_full++;
+		return false;
+	}
+
+	get_page(buf_info->page);
+
+	cache->ring[cache->tail] = *buf_info;
+	cache->tail = tail_next;
+	stats->cache_put++;
+
+	return true;
+}
+
+static bool ionic_rx_cache_get(struct ionic_queue *q,
 			       struct ionic_buf_info *buf_info)
+{
+	struct ionic_page_cache *cache = &q->page_cache;
+	struct ionic_rx_stats *stats = q_to_rx_stats(q);
+
+	if (unlikely(cache->head == cache->tail)) {
+		stats->cache_empty++;
+		return false;
+	}
+
+	if (page_ref_count(cache->ring[cache->head].page) != 1) {
+		stats->cache_busy++;
+		return false;
+	}
+
+	*buf_info = cache->ring[cache->head];
+	cache->head = (cache->head + 1) & (IONIC_PAGE_CACHE_SIZE - 1);
+	stats->cache_get++;
+
+	dma_sync_single_for_device(q->dev, buf_info->dma_addr,
+				   IONIC_PAGE_SIZE,
+				   DMA_FROM_DEVICE);
+
+	return true;
+}
+
+static void ionic_rx_cache_drain(struct ionic_queue *q)
+{
+	struct ionic_page_cache *cache = &q->page_cache;
+	struct ionic_rx_stats *stats = q_to_rx_stats(q);
+	struct ionic_buf_info *buf_info;
+
+	while (cache->head != cache->tail) {
+		buf_info = &cache->ring[cache->head];
+		dma_unmap_page(q->dev, buf_info->dma_addr, IONIC_PAGE_SIZE,
+			       DMA_FROM_DEVICE);
+		put_page(buf_info->page);
+		cache->head = (cache->head + 1) & (IONIC_PAGE_CACHE_SIZE - 1);
+	}
+
+	cache->head = 0;
+	cache->tail = 0;
+	stats->cache_empty = 0;
+	stats->cache_busy = 0;
+	stats->cache_get = 0;
+	stats->cache_put = 0;
+	stats->cache_full = 0;
+}
+
+static bool ionic_rx_buf_reuse(struct ionic_queue *q,
+			       struct ionic_buf_info *buf_info, u32 used)
+{
+	struct ionic_rx_stats *stats = q_to_rx_stats(q);
+	u32 size;
+
+	if (!dev_page_is_reusable(buf_info->page)) {
+		stats->buf_not_reusable++;
+		return false;
+	}
+
+	size = ALIGN(used, IONIC_PAGE_SPLIT_SZ);
+	buf_info->page_offset += size;
+	if (buf_info->page_offset >= IONIC_PAGE_SIZE) {
+		buf_info->page_offset = 0;
+		stats->buf_exhausted++;
+		return false;
+	}
+
+	stats->buf_reused++;
+
+	get_page(buf_info->page);
+
+	return true;
+}
+
+static void ionic_rx_buf_complete(struct ionic_queue *q,
+				  struct ionic_buf_info *buf_info, u32 used)
+{
+	if (ionic_rx_buf_reuse(q, buf_info, used))
+		return;
+
+	if (!ionic_rx_cache_put(q, buf_info))
+		dma_unmap_page_attrs(q->dev, buf_info->dma_addr, IONIC_PAGE_SIZE,
+				     DMA_FROM_DEVICE, DMA_ATTR_SKIP_CPU_SYNC);
+
+	buf_info->page = NULL;
+}

From: Jakub Kicinski @ 2023-02-04  4:28 UTC (permalink / raw)
  To: Shannon Nelson; +Cc: netdev, davem, drivers, Neel Patel

On Fri, 3 Feb 2023 13:00:16 -0800 Shannon Nelson wrote:
> From: Neel Patel <neel.patel@amd.com>
> 
> Use a local page cache to optimize page allocation & dma mapping.

Please use the page_pool API rather than creating your own caches.
